What causes trees or limbs to fracture? Strong winds usually harm trees during storms. Accumulated heavy, wet snow can snap limbs in winter.

 

Trees can fail for other reasons, too. Roots die. Excessive water gathers at the base. Extended drought weakens overall health.

 

Some trees are just more robust than others. Branch strength can vary, for example. Native tree species typically endure harsh Washington County weather better.

 

In scenarios where branches break, the resulting wound is an invitation to insects and disease. The limb stub should be pruned back to the trunk to promote healing. The ISA-Certified Arborists at Dorshak Tree Specialists are experts at trimming broken limbs to minimize long-term effects.
